Comparison with Other Sizes

To better understand whether a 4.2 L air fryer is big, it’s helpful to compare it with other common sizes available in the market.

  • Small air fryers (2-3 liters): Ideal for 1-3 people, these models are compact and perfect for singles, couples, or small families. They are great for cooking smaller meals or snacks.
  • Medium air fryers (3.5-5 liters): Suitable for 4-6 people, these air fryers offer a good balance between cooking capacity and kitchen space. They are versatile and can handle a variety of dishes.
  • Large air fryers (5.5 liters and above): Designed for larger families or for those who cook in bulk, these models offer extensive cooking capacity but require more space and might be more expensive.

Can a 4.2 L air fryer fit on a standard kitchen counter?

The size of a standard kitchen counter can vary, but most counters are around 36-42 inches high and 25-30 inches deep. A 4.2 L air fryer typically measures around 13-15 inches in width, 12-14 inches in depth, and 15-17 inches in height. Based on these dimensions, a 4.2 L air fryer can fit on a standard kitchen counter, but it may take up a significant amount of space. To ensure a comfortable fit, it’s essential to measure your counter space accurately and consider the air fryer’s size and shape before making a purchase.
